Military Prosecution Demands More Than Two Years Imprisonment for Bil'in's Abdallah Abu Rahmah

Military prosecutor said harsh sentence should serve as a deterrent to other protesters. Despite military orders to the contrary, army officer said 0.22" caliber bullets are considered crowd control measures.

Bil'in's Abdallah Abu Rahmah's Trial to Enter Sentencing Phase on Wednesday

The trial of Bil'in protest organizer, Abdallah Abu Rahmah will renew this Wednesday, after his conviction of incitement and organizing illegal demonstrations was harshly criticized by the EU, the Spanish Parliament and human rights organizations.
